Description
4 watch cases with timepieces, each decorated with precious metals and gems. One has a salamander for the hands.
Made by C. Saunier after A. Racinet.
Medium: Handcoloured engraving with gold heightening on wove (vellin) paper.
Sheet size: 20 x 27.5 cm (7.87 x 10.83 inch). Image size: 19 x 25 cm. (7.48 x 9.84 inch).

BACKGROUND INFORMATION
This print originates from the Horlogerie volume of ‘Collection arche?ologique du Prince Pierre Soltykoff’, a large work by Pierre Dubois, with illustrations by Clerget and Racinet. Published 1858 in Paris.
Biography engraver: Charles Saunier (1815-1889) was a French engraver. Albert Racinet (1825-1893) was a French painter and draughtsman.
